Deep Dive: The Alchemy of Conscious Love

The Magician's power in love stems from a profound spiritual principle: as above, so below. In the romantic realm, this means your internal state (your thoughts, beliefs, and self-concept) directly shapes your external reality (the relationships you attract and experience). This card, following The Fool's leap of faith, is about landing on solid ground and getting to work. Where The Fool is potential, The Magician is the first step of actualization.

The Magician in love teaches: You are not a passive character in your romantic story. You are the author, the director, and the lead actor, holding the pen, the megaphone, and the script.

This manifests through the four elemental tools on the Magician's table, which are crucial for healthy relationships:

  • The Sword (Air): Represents clear, conscious communication. It's the ability to articulate desires, set boundaries, and engage in intellectual intimacy.
  • The Wand (Fire): Symbolizes passion, sexual energy, and the creative spark that initiates action. It's the courage to ask someone out or propose a new idea in the relationship.
  • The Cup (Water): Stands for emotional flow, empathy, intuition, and vulnerability. It's the capacity to connect heart-to-heart and nurture the emotional bond.
  • The Pentacle (Earth): Embodies the practical, stable foundations—reliability, planning dates, sharing resources, and building a tangible life together.

Rapid FAQ: The Magician in Your Love Life

Does The Magician mean I will manifest a specific person?

The Magician emphasizes manifesting the *qualities* of a relationship, not necessarily a predetermined individual. It's about aligning your energy with the experience you desire—be it passion, respect, or intellectual synergy—and taking actionable steps toward social circles and activities where such a partner is likely to be found. The universe responds to your clear, energized frequency, not a specific name or face.

What if I get The Magician reversed in a love reading?

The Magician reversed suggests a blockage in your manifesting power. This could mean: unclear intentions, manipulative behavior (from you or a partner), untapped potential, or a failure to communicate authentically. It's a call to introspect. Are your words aligning with your true feelings? Are you waiting for love to happen *to* you? Reversed, it asks you to reclaim your tools, heal your self-doubt, and realign your will with your heart's true desire before proceeding.

How does The Magician's energy differ from The Fool's in love?

While both are about new beginnings, their energies are distinct. The Fool is about innocent, faith-based leaps into the unknown—a spontaneous crush or a relationship that begins with a sense of destiny and adventure. The Magician is the next step: it's about applying skill, intention, and effort to build upon that beginning. The Fool jumps off the cliff; The Magician builds the bridge. In a sequence, The Fool might represent meeting someone new, and The Magician would be the conscious decision to pursue a first date and make a memorable impression.
